The nationalist movement in India paralleled cultural development by fostering a sense of identity and unity among diverse groups through the revival of indigenous art, literature, and traditions. As leaders like Rabindranath Tagore and Bankim Chandra Chatterjee promoted cultural nationalism, they emphasized the value of Indian heritage, which became intertwined with the political struggle for independence. This cultural renaissance not only inspired the masses but also provided a framework for articulating aspirations for self-rule, leading to a greater collective consciousness. Thus, the nationalist movement and cultural development reinforced each other, shaping India's quest for independence.
